Output 7590725f7359111e5082748ac9b762f472b0d08ea4b52c43ec065629fe66ea38:7

value
527110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8521c2080b67824288c807f363df906a8e0b3c8b OP_EQUALVERIFY OP_CHECKSIG
address
1D8wK4F59ZPzBk1SFtLgZ242gePN9odtVM
transaction
7590725f7359111e5082748ac9b762f472b0d08ea4b52c43ec065629fe66ea38
spent
true